Politics Motivational Quotes



Best Quotes about Politics

1.
Politics is a blood sport.
Bevan, Aneurin

2.
Many politicians lay it down as a self-evident proposition, that no people ought to be free till they are fit to use their freedom. The maxim is worthy of the fool in the old story, who resolved not to go into the water till he had learned to swim.
Macaulay, Lord

3.
What this country needs is more unemployed politicians.
Langley, Edward

4.
A passion for politics stems usually from an insatiable need, either for power, or for friendship and adulation, or a combination of both.
Brodie, Fawn M.

5.
In politics, it seems, retreat is honorable if dictated by military considerations and shameful if even suggested for ethical reasons.
Mccarthy, Mary

6.
Party leads to vicious, corrupt and unprofitable legislation, for the sole purpose of defeating party.
Cooper, James F.

7.
I have come to the conclusion that politics is too serious a matter to be left to the politicians.
Gaulle, Charles De

8.
Few businessmen are capable of being in politics, they don't understand the democratic process, they have neither the tolerance or the depth it takes. Democracy isn't a business.
Forbes, Malcolm S.

9.
People who leave Washington do so by way of the box... ballet or coffin.
Pell, Claiborne

10.
What in fact takes place in an election is that two hand picked candidates are propped up before the citizenry, each candidate having been selected by a very small group of politically active people. A minority of the people... then elects one of these hand picked people to rule itself and the majority.
Ringer, Robert J.

11.
It is the eternal truth in the political as well as the mystical body, that, where one members suffers, all the members suffer with it.
Junius

12.
The work of the political activist inevitably involves a certain tension between the requirement that position be taken on current issues as they arise and the desire that one's contributions will somehow survive the ravages of time.
Davis, Angela Y.

13.
It is a vain hope to make people happy by politics.
Carlyle, Thomas

14.
What the statesman is most anxious to produce is a certain moral character in his fellow citizens, namely a disposition to virtue and the performance of virtuous actions.
Aristotle

15.
A candidate could easily commit political suicide if he were to come up with an unconventional thought during a presidential tour.
White, Elwyn Brooks

16.
Every clique is a refuge for incompetence. It fosters corruption and disloyalty, it begets cowardice, and consequently is a burden upon and a drawback to the progress of the country. Its instincts and actions are those of the pack.
Chiang Kai-Shek, Madame

17.
A political leader must keep looking over his shoulder all the time to see if the boys are still there. If they aren't still there, he's no longer a political leader.
Baruch, Bernard M.

18.
Nobody is a friend of ours. Let's face it.
Nixon, Richard M.

19.
Idealism is the noble toga that political gentlemen drape over their will to power.
Huxley, Aldous

20.
In politics the middle way is none at all.
Adams, John

21.
Political speech and writing are largely the defense of the indefensible.
Orwell, George

22.
The more you read and observe about this politics thing, the more you've got to admit that each party's worse than the other. The one that's out always looks the best.
Rogers, Will

23.
The word'politics'is derived from the word'poly', meaning'many', and the word'ticks', meaning'blood sucking parasites'.
Larry Hardiman

24.
The success of a party means little more than that the Nation is using the party for a large and definite purpose. It seeks to use and interpret a change in its own plans and point of view.
Wilson, Woodrow T.

25.
Until you've been in politics you've never really been alive; it's rough and sometimes it's dirty and it's always hard work and tedious details. But, it's the only sport for grown-ups all other games are for kids.

26.
The greatest art of a politician is to render vice serviceable to the cause of virtue.
Bolingbroke, Henry

27.
Politics has become so expensive that it takes a lot of money even to be defeated.
Rogers, Will

28.
What do you want to be a sailor for? There are greater storms in politics than you will ever find at sea. Piracy, broadsides, blood on the decks. You will find them all in politics.
George, David Lloyd

29.
Politics will sooner or later make fools of everybody.
Armey, Dick

30.
An empty stomach is not a good political advisor.
Einstein, Albert

31.
It takes a politician to run a government. A statesman is a politician who's been dead for fifteen years.
Truman, Harry S

32.
As usual the Liberals offer a mixture of sound and original ideas. Unfortunately none of the sound ideas is original and none of the original ideas is sound.
Macmillan, Harold

33.
It only takes a politician believing in what he says for the others to stop believing him.
Baudrillard, Jean

34.
In politics... shared hatreds are almost always the basis of friendships.
Tocqueville, Alexis De

35.
There is no sea more dangerous than the ocean of practical politics -- none in which there is more need of good pilots and of a single, unfaltering purpose when the waves rise high.
Huxley, Thomas H.

36.
Ninety-eight percent of the adults in this country are decent, hard-working Americans. It is the other lousy two percent that get all the publicity. But then, we elected them.
Tomlin, Lily

37.
I played by the rules of politics as I found them.
Nixon, Richard M.

38.
Sincerity and competence is a strong combination. In politics, it is everything.
Noonan, Peggy

39.
Nothing can be said about our politics that has not already been said about hemorrhoids.

40.
Ninety percent of politics is deciding whom to blame.
Greenfield, Meg

41.
What is a democrat? One who believes that the republicans have ruined the country. What is a republican? One who believes that the democrats would ruin the country.
Bierce, Ambrose

42.
Away with the cant of Measures, not men! -- the idle supposition that it is the harness and not the horses that draw the chariot along. No, Sir, if the comparison must be made, if the distinction must be taken, men are everything, measures comparatively nothing.
Canning, George

43.
I have come to the conclusion that politics are too serious a matter to be left to the politicians.
Charles De Gaulle

44.
People start parades -- politicians just get out in front and act like they're leading.
Rinehart, Dana Gillman

45.
A party of order or stability, and a party of progress or reform, are both necessary elements of a healthy state of political life.
Mill, John Stuart

46.
In order to remain true to oneself one ought to renounce one's party three times a day.
Rostand, Jean

47.
People with high ideals don't necessarily make good politicians. If clean politics is so important, we should leave the job to scientists and the clergy.
Watanabe, Michio

48.
A Whig is properly what is called a Trimmer -- that is, a coward to both sides of the question, who dare not be a knave nor an honest man, but is a sort of whiffing, shuffling, cunning, silly, contemptible, unmeaning negation of the two.
Hazlitt, William

49.
The House of Lords is the British Outer Mongolia for retired politicians.
Benn, Tony

50.
Any established village; could afford a town drunkard, a town atheist, and a few Democrats.
Brogan, Denis E.
